How do I choose the right leather full grain backpack for my needs?
Start by matching your daily routine with four core factors: leather quality, size and capacity, features, and durability. In particular, look for genuine full grain leather construction for longevity and a natural patina, plus waterproofing for all-weather use. If you carry a laptop, choose a bag with a dedicated sleeve; for security, prefer a hidden anti-theft pocket; and for travel, a luggage strap can be a big help. Choose a silhouette and color that suits your daily wear and remember you’re investing in long-term durability, so prioritize brands that emphasize craftsmanship.
What does full-grain leather construction mean for a leather full grain backpack, and why does it matter?
Full-grain leather uses the outermost skin with minimal processing, delivering the strongest, most durable surface. It ages gracefully, developing a unique patina and better wear resistance than corrected-grain leathers, especially when regularly conditioned. In backpacks, this translates to long-lasting shape, fewer scuffs, and a premium feel that improves with time. Care is essential: wipe with a damp cloth, apply a leather conditioner every 6–12 months, avoid harsh chemicals, and store away from direct heat to keep the finish intact.

How do I maintain and ensure compatibility of a leather full grain backpack with my devices and everyday gear?
Condition the leather periodically and wipe away dirt with a damp cloth to preserve the surface. Check the bag’s sleeve dimensions to confirm your laptop or tablet will fit, and adjust the padded shoulder straps for comfort. Use the luggage strap when traveling to secure it to a bag or trolley. Avoid overloading the bag to maintain its shape and protect hardware like zippers and buckles.
